House Trim Installation in Wilmington, NC
House trim installation services involve attaching decorative and protective moldings, such as baseboards, crown molding, window casings, and door trims, to enhance the appearance and functionality of interior and exterior spaces. These projects typically include upgrading or replacing existing trim, adding new details to improve curb appeal, or customizing trims to match specific design preferences. Property owners often seek these services to give their homes a finished look, improve interior aesthetics, or address damage caused by wear and tear.
Before requesting house trim installation, homeowners should consider the types of materials they prefer, such as wood, MDF, or composite, as well as the scope of the project-whether it involves interior accents or exterior details. Understanding the existing architecture and style of the home can help in selecting appropriate trim designs. Additionally, property owners usually want to know about the overall cost, the estimated time for completion, and any preparation needed prior to installation to ensure a smooth process.

Common House Trim Installation Jobs
Crown Molding - adds a refined finishing touch to living rooms and hallways.
Baseboard Installation - provides a clean transition between walls and floors.
Door and Window Trim - enhances the appearance and functionality of entryways.
Wainscoting and Paneling - elevates interior style with decorative wall accents.
Ceiling Beadboard - creates a classic look in kitchens and bathrooms.
Custom Trim Projects - tailor-made solutions to match unique interior design preferences.
House Trim Installation Questions
What types of trim can be installed on a house? Common options include window casings, door trim, crown molding, and soffits to enhance interior and exterior aesthetics.
How does house trim installation improve property appearance? Proper trim adds definition and detail, creating a polished look that complements the overall style of the home.
Is house trim installation suitable for both new and existing homes? Yes, trim can be added or replaced on new constructions as well as on renovations or upgrades of older properties.
What materials are typically used for house trim? Common materials include wood, PVC, and composite options, chosen based on durability, style, and maintenance preferences.
